BossaNova has greenlit the true-crime program The Killer Clown: Murder on the Doorstep from Flicker Productions.
The three-parter will tell the story of Marlene Warren, a wife and mother who was shot in the face on the doorstep of her Florida home by a clown bearing balloons and flowers in front of her 21-year-old son and his friends in 1990. Amid rumors of infidelity, her husband Michael was a prime suspect but had a solid alibi and was never charged. Three decades later, his alleged mistress and subsequent second wife Sheila was arrested for the crime.
Although maintaining her innocence, Sheila agreed to plead guilty to second-degree murder to avoid a potential life sentence.
The Killer Clown has already been presold to AMC Networks’ Sundance Now in the U.S. and Sky in the U.K. and Germany.

BossaNova has also signed a slew of international deals for other crime content on its slate. BBC Select USA and Play Belgium bought Accused of Murdering Our Son: The Steven Clark Story. Play Belgium also picked up The Push, The Flight Attendant Murders and Cold Case Killers. Viasat acquired Con Girl for its channels in the Baltics, CEE, Scandinavia and CIS, as well as The Cannibal Next Door. CANAL+ licensed Con Girl and The Flight Attendant Murders.
